Surgeon
Average Salary: The salary of a surgeon varies a lot based on their specialty and skill. The average annual income of a surgeon in the United States is $351,794.
Education Requirements: Becoming a surgeon requires 4 years  undergrad, 4 years of medical school, a 5-7 year residency in a hospital, and a 1 year fellowship. The long process is why most people do not strive to become surgeons, that and the blood.  
Personality Traits: intelligent, conscientious, creative, courageous, responsible and demonstrate perseverance.

Anesthesiologist
Average  Salary: On average, anesthesiologists make $300,000. As they make progress in their careers, they can earn up to 450,000.
Education Requirements: Although the process is not nearly as long as becoming a surgeon, it is still 4 years undergrad, 4 years medical school, and 3 years of residency.
Personality Traits: Attentive, proficient multitaskers, good bedside manner, and detail oriented.

Family Physician
Average Salary: Family physicians on average make $189,000, but this number can vary based on the company they work for.
Education Requirements: Bachelor's degree (4 years), 4 years of medical school, Family medicine internship, and 5 year residency

Personality Traits: Excellent interpersonal skills, compassionate, good work ethic, enthusiasm to learn, maturity, honesty, trustworthy, and a sense of humor.
